Welcome back to your cozy farm in the wasteland!

Doloc Town features over 30 hours of core gameplay, along with more than a hundred hours of additional content. Start out as a hardworking scavenger and gradually build your way up to becoming a farm owner who can sit back and watch the harvest roll in!

For Players Who Love Farming, Fishing, and Management Sims

For farming enthusiasts, Doloc Town offers more than 30+ crops, 40+ post-apocalyptic resources, 40+ species of fish, 80+ crafting recipes, and over 10 types of buildings.

Make full use of every item you find and build your own farm in the apocalypse from scratch. Gather resources, grow crops, fish, raise animals, cook meals, process materials, construct platforms, build automated production pipelines, and even genetically modify your crops.

With a wide variety of activities and a high degree of freedom, Doloc Town offers a rich and rewarding farming experience.

For Players Who Love Exploration and Bullet-Hell Combat

Explorers may venture across three large maps area featuring a wide range of changing environments, including the outskirts, mining areas, forests, river valleys, wetlands, caves, as well as the Old City Ruins.

Discover hidden resources, uncover secret passages and concealed areas, piece together scattered clues, and reveal the untold stories buried across this land.

Each region also features its own specially designed enemies. Equip your combat drone and take on thrilling bullet-hell battles throughout this side-scrolling pixel world!

For Players Who Enjoy Socializing and Building Bonds

For those who love getting to know the people around them, Doloc Town features unique relationship storylines for 13 townsfolk.

Visit each resident and build meaningful relationships with them. You may help someone recover a lost possession, support them as they overcome something from their past, or simply listen as they recall the glory of days gone by.

Nurture friendships, form lasting bonds, and discover the stories behind the people of Doloc Town.

Even in this peaceful refuge amid the apocalypse, people still celebrate festivals passed down from the “Old World.” When festival season arrives, the town comes alive with colorful decorations and special activities.

Craft festival items alongside the townsfolk, deepen the precious bonds you have formed, and find moments of warmth, healing, and happiness in this harsh post-apocalyptic world.

Doloc Town 1.0 Full Release Patch Notes

New Content

  • Added a new area: Old City Ruins, featuring new NPCs, enemies, resources, and points of interests to explore.

  • Added new main quests and story content, bringing the main storyline to its conclusion.

  • Added new components for the Environmental Modifier

  • Added a new system: Farming Automation, including Industrial Tech Tree nodes, related equipment, and tutorial quests.

  • Added a new festival: Mushroom Fest.

  • Added relationship storylines for four NPCs: Zenis, Villain, Cod, and Hult.

  • Added the final farm expansion tier.

  • Added Farming Plots in the wild, must be unlocked through quests.

  • Added two new tool tiers: Titanium and Gold.

  • Added new Tech Tree nodes and corresponding equipment to the Lifestyle and Ranching Tech Trees, completing all Tech Tree content.

  • Added a new item: Portable Audio Player, allowing you to play collected cassette tapes anytime and anywhere.

  • Added a new series of collectible cassette tapes that can be discovered while exploring.

  • Added a series of decorative enemy statues, available from Orlando’s shop.

  • Added a series of new combat drones and related components.

  • Added a series of new accessories.

  • Added a series of new faction quests.

  • Added a series of new fish.

  • Added 37 new achievements, bringing the total amount to 80.

  • Added two new BGM tracks.

  • Added a feature for taking panoramic screenshots of your farm.

  • Added an option to hide combat drones during cutscenes.

  • Added an option to disable the nighttime flickering effect of streetlights.

  • Added beta localization support for Japanese, Korean, French, Russian, Brazilian Portuguese, and German.

Balacing Changes and Resource Adjustments

  • Added coin rewards to early-game quests and increased the coin rewards for submitting crops to the Archive, easing financial pressure during the early game.

  • Reduced the time required to smelt high-tier metal ingots.

  • Adjusted the crafting recipes and selling prices of certain machines and industrial products.

  • Increased the production requirements and value of industrial materials such as Sand, Glass, and Rubber, while reducing the quantities required by related recipes accordingly.

  • Increased the efficiency of obtaining Coal and reduced the amount of Coal required to produce industrial goods.

  • Increased the number of Stone items dropped by stone resources.

  • Increased the amount of Soil dropped by Soil Piles and Wet Soil Piles.

  • Adjusted the drop sources and drop rates of mineral collectibles.

  • Increased the rarity and value of Gold Ore.

  • Adjusted the resource distribution in the Back Mountain Mining Area, accessed by cable car, making Iron Ore and Gold Ore more likely to appear.

  • Adjusted resource and vegetation spawn positions in the Outskirts to reduce overlapping spawns.

  • Adjusted the spawn rates of various fish. The spawn rate of the Gold Fish will no longer decrease significantly as environmental restoration progresses.

  • Adjusted the requirements and rewards of certain faction quests so that their rewards better match their difficulty.

  • Reduced the time required for animals to produce special produces and increased the selling prices of those products.

  • Reduced the chance of animals escaping.

  • Increased the selling prices and recovery effects of certain food items.

Combat Adjustments

  • Increased the maximum HP bonus granted by the Eden Fruit, which has been renamed as Eden Fruit Essence.

  • Adjusted the attack mechanics of the Mechanical Greatsword, allowing it to attack automatically.

  • Rebalanced firearms to reduce the performance gap between weapons of the same tier.

  • Adjusted the stats of Enhancement Chips so that every chip type has a practical use.

  • Adjusted battery-related stats for drone frames and engines.

  • Adjusted the stats and crafting recipes of certain support modules.

  • Increased the critical damage multiplier of firearms from 1.5× to 2×.

  • Increased the damage dealt to monsters by tools.

  • Slightly increased the player’s invincibility duration after taking damage.

  • Removed defense stat from all monsters except festival bosses and rebalanced monster difficulty accordingly.

  • Adjusted thrown bombs so that they no longer explode upon hitting platforms.

  • Adjusted rubber barrage so that they bounce off walls but no longer bounce after hitting monsters.

  • Adjusted the effect of the No. 66 Mask, allowing it to make all monsters in the corresponding series neutral.

  • Reduced the HP and damage of the New Year monster.

  • Adjusted monster distribution in the Wetlands.

Other Improvements & Adjustments

  • Improved item submission interactions. Items stored inside cardboard boxes can now be submitted directly.

  • Improved cooking equipment. Free Cooking Mode now supports batch cooking.

  • Increased the maximum item stack size from 99 to 999.

  • Improved player controls by slightly increasing the protagonist’s movement speed.

  • Improved well functionality. Water no longer needs to be drawn manually.

  • Improved the Power Control Room. Generators placed within the outdoor building area can now benefit from its bonuses.

  • Improved the platforming experience at Western Cliff by increasing the size of landing pads.

  • Improved the in-game wiki by adding new categories for Collectibles, Tools, and Equipment.

  • Optimized the interior of the Treaty Port and Blacksmith.

  • Improved the presentation of the Salmon Fest, including new festival decorations at the docks and adjustments to NPC festival schedules.

  • Improved the protagonist’s status-bar UI. The protagonist’s portrait will now display different expressions depending on their current condition.

  • Improved Zenis' animations by adding a glass-wiping animation.

  • Improved interactions at bus stops by adding bus animations.

  • Improved the Combat Drone interface. Components can now be equipped more quickly, and players can switch directly between different drones.

  • Improved equipment replacement and swapping.

  • Improved inventory controls. Hold Shift and left-click to quickly equip an item.

  • Improved UI visibility. The item hotbar will now become hidden when the protagonist overlaps with it.

  • Improved item descriptions for weapons and batteries by adding battery-capacity information.

  • Improved navigation for Tech Tree node information.

  • Improved Display Stands, allowing them to display complete drones together with their components.

  • Improved the Treaty Port communication interface. A special visual effect will now appear upon reaching maximum reputation.

  • Improved the positions where expression icons appear above the protagonist and NPCs.

  • Improved the icons for recipe and blueprint items.

  • Improved the visual effects of damage numbers.

  • Improved the calendar by giving different festivals distinct icons.

  • Improved fertilizer sprites.

  • Improved tutorial illustrations.

  • Adjusted the save-file location and changed the save-file naming format to [c]doloc-save-0.data[/c]. The number of automatically backed-up save files has also been increased.

  • Adjusted BGM playback. Different seasons, special locations, and special weather conditions now have their own BGM playlists.

  • Replaced the in-game’s four “months” with four seasons:

    • Month 1 → Light Rain Season

    • Month 2 → Heavy Rain Season

    • Month 3 → Early Dry Season

    • Month 4 → Harsh Dry Season

  • Adjusted the weather system so that different regions now have distinct weather tendencies. The Wetlands remain in the rainy season throughout the year, while the Old City remains in the dry season.

  • Adjusted the probability of different weather conditions appearing during each season to better reflect their seasonal characteristics.

  • Adjusted certain equipment recipes that previously required Old Chips. They now require standard Chips, which can be crafted using the Assembly Shaper.

  • Adjusted the layout around the entrance to the River Valley Outpost and added a small farming plot for Mira.

  • Adjusted the interior layout of the Outpost and added a Handcrafting Workbench.

  • Adjusted the items found inside treasure chests at Doloc Center and Doloc Docks.

  • Adjusted the Premium Planted Tank, allowing it to produce Kelp.

  • Adjusted the placement restrictions of the Compost Bin and Tree Compost Bin, allowing them to be placed indoors.

  • Adjusted enemy hit reactions. Enemies can no longer be permanently stun-locked by bullets.

  • Adjusted the buildable areas for Tents and Small Livestock Sheds.

  • Adjusted the time at which town lights turn on at night.

  • Adjusted the display order of entries in the Plant Archive and Chip Archive.

  • Increased the water capacity of the Copper Watering Can.

  • Increased the efficiency of obtaining energy for the Environmental Modifier Equipment.

  • Increased the power generation of Solar Generators.

  • Reduced the power consumption of the Seed Analyzer.

  • Added Moonlight Song to Zenis' shop.

  • Added three Seed Packs to Viilain’s shop, unlocked as the game progresses.

  • Added a series of handmade flowers to Kasia’s shop, unlocked after completing Kasia’s relationship storyline.

  • Added Animal Feed to the Kenenimuu's Shop, unlocked after completing the faction settlement requirements.

  • Added the Witch’s Lightning Rod to the Witch’s shop.

  • Fixed a series of known issues in the current version.
